Who We Are:

CarePartners is one of Ontario’s largest accredited home health care providers, providing nursing, personal support, therapy and rehabilitation support services for patients of all ages. We care for approximately 72,000 patients each year in homes, schools, clinics, workplaces and retirement homes, through our 24 locations and 23 nursing clinics. CarePartners is proud of its commitment to quality, relentlessly seeking to improve the patient and caregiver experience, promoting a healthy and resilient workplace culture, and contributing to a sustainable healthcare system in Ontario.

What The Role Involves:

Project Management

  • Define project scope, objectives, deliverables, and success criteria in collaboration with stakeholders.
  • Develop detailed project plans, schedules, budgets, and resource allocations.
  • Monitor project progress, manage risks and issues, and ensure timely delivery of milestones.
  • Report on project status to sponsors and leadership, ensuring transparency and accountability.
  • Ensure all parties (internal and external) are aware of project scope and milestones. Highlight deviations from project scope and adjust where necessary to reflect changing circumstances.
  • Manage vendor(s) within defined contract parameters.
  • Facilitate the identification and resolution of project issues; ensure issues are raised to the executive sponsor and/or steering committee and solutions are provided for timely decision making.
  • Manage project related risks.
  • Produce all required project management documentation, such as detailed project plans, work plans, product delivery schedules, project estimates, budget, resource plans, status reports, risk and issue logs.
  • Develop and implement change management strategies when appropriate, including plans to maximize employee adoption and minimize resistance.
  • Measure and report on change adoption, engagement, and benefits realization as part of the overall project plan.
  • Facilitate integration of new practices into existing organizational systems and structures (e.g. updates to orientation materials), and handover to appropriate business leads to support sustainment

Collaboration

  • Work closely with Senior Leadership Sponsor, Business Lead, project teams, other business leaders, and stakeholders to integrate change management into project delivery.

  • Act as a liaison between technical teams and end users to ensure alignment and address concerns.

CarePartners In Your Community:

In addition to providing home-based health care, CarePartners also serves the community through clinics, transitional care units, and provides relief in retirement homes and shared care settings. Through our Community Nursing Services outreach program, we’ve been organizing staff-led medical care and clinics in countries with poor access to health care since 2009.
